Elijah Pierce (boxer)


Elijah Pierce is an American professional boxer who has held the WBO International featherweight title since July 2025.

Amateur career

Pierce, born in Midwest City, Oklahoma, fought in regional championships at the United States as an amateur, he gained victories against a handful of boxers such as former World Boxing Association super lightweight champion Rolando Romero, he also has plenty of losses, with the likes of Hector Tanajara Jr. He also fondly recalls a rivalry with top prospect Bruce Carrington in an interview.

Professional career

Early years

On July 23, 2016, Pierce began his professional career as a lightweight and made his debut match against Deartie Tucker in Remington Park, Oklahoma City. In the fight, Tucker weighed 139 pounds, whilst Pierce weighed 5 pounds lighter, Pierce won via 1st round TKO, finishing the bout within 2 minutes and 49 seconds.
Pierce moved down to the super featherweight division in his third bout against debutant Xavier Siller, Pierce won via third round TKO. Pierce returned to the lightweight division against journeyman Anthony Dave, who he would defeat via second-round KO. In his next bout, Pierce moved back down to the super featherweight division to defeat undefeated Mexican Calendario Alejandro Rochin.

Pierce vs. Cabrera

After amassing a record of 8–0, 7 KOs, Pierce moved to the featherweight division. On June 9, 2018, Pierce gambled his undefeated status against fellow undefeated compatriot Giovanni Cabrera at the Emerald Queen Casino located in Tacoma, Washington, Pierce concedes his first loss as Cabrera scores a 10-round unanimous decision victory.

Pierce vs. Gonzalez

11 months later, on May 17, 2019, Pierce was scheduled against 12–0, 9 KOs prospect Irvin Gonzalez. Prior to the fight, Pierce was a +1000 underdog, but Pierce proved the odds-maker wrong as he scored a huge upset, dropping Gonzalez two times in the opening round before finishing Gonzalez in the third round.

Pierce vs. Segawa

On September 28, 2019, Pierce was matched against Ugandan prospect Sulaiman Segawa, Pierce lost for the second time with a close majority decision, whilst Segawa improved to 13 wins with 2 defeats.
After improving to 12–2, 11 KOs, Pierce fought undefeated Jesse Garcia on June 4, 2022 in Houston, Texas. Pierce won the fight by third round TKO. Supposedly, Pierce was to fight Filipino regional challenger Joseph Ambo, however, the bout wasn't continued, Pierce instead fought American Ryizeemmion Ford, Pierce won via majority decision.
On October 15, 2022 in Live! Casino & Hotel, Hanover, Maryland, Pierce won the vacant WBC Silver super bantamweight title in Pierce's debut in the super bantamweight division with a second-round knockout against Washington D.C.-based Daron Williams.
On November 19, 2022, Pierce defeated veteran Juan Carlos Peña via 2nd round TKO in Oklahoma City.

Rise up the ranks

Pierce vs. Williams

On April 22, 2023, Pierce was scheduled with former WBO World title-challenger Tramaine Williams for the vacant WBC Silver super bantamweight strap in a 10-rounder bout in Mohegan Sun Arena, Uncasville, Connecticut, Pierce upsets Williams scoring a unanimous decision victory with 2 judges scoring 97–93 and 1 judge scoring 96–94.

Pierce vs. Plania

On August 4, 2023, Pierce dueled Filipino challenger and former IBF North American champion Mike Plania to headline Overtime Elite-based Overtime Boxing Summer Boxing Series in Overtime Elite Arena, Atlanta, Georgia. After Plania being in much control of the fight, Pierce bounced back with a one-punch KO in the third round that concluded the fight.

Pierce vs. Villanueva

On March 29, 2024, Pierce fought ex-ALA Promotions stalwart ring veteran Arthur Villanueva in Overtime Elite Arena, Atlanta, Georgia, Pierce survived a second-round knockdown, but Pierce was able to stand up and avenged the ensuing round, eventually, Pierce stopped Villanueva in the fourth round.

Pierce vs. Sanmartin

On August 30, 2024, Pierce was scheduled against Colombian veteran Jose Sanmartin for the vacant WBA Continental Americas super bantamweight title, Pierce won via unanimous decision.

Pierce vs. Parra
